Have Iraqi militias fired the first round of Iran’s retaliation?
Amid heightened tension in the Middle East, on the evening of Aug. 5, five U.S. soldiers were wounded in a strike fired at the Ain al-Assad air base in the northwest of Baghdad.
It seems that the Americans were taken by surprise. Although the region is on high alert, awaiting Iran’s response to the assassination of Ismail Haniyeh in the middle of Tehran, five U.S. soldiers were wounded on Monday evening in an attack on the Ain al-Assad air base in Iraq.A rocket targeted the secure compound in the northwest of Baghdad that houses U.S. military personnel present in Iraq as part of the fight against the Islamic State group (ISIS). All eyes immediately turned to Hezbollah Brigades [Kataeb Hezbollah], which a few days earlier were hit by a U.S. strike that killed four people in Jurf al-Sakhar.
